Context window: DeepSeek Chat vs OpenAI GPT-4o Mini

Context is how much text fits in one request. DeepSeek Chat allows up to 640,000 tokens. OpenAI GPT-4o Mini allows up to 128,000. DeepSeek Chat fits longer docs or repos—but you pay for every token you send, every turn. Do not max the window unless you need it. In plain words: Strong for long reports, transcripts, and mid-size repos. For the other side: Standard for chat + medium docs; chunk bigger sources.

Vision and image processing

DeepSeek Chat is text-only here. GPT-4o Mini supports vision (about $0.00765 per image). Resize images before the API when you can—it lowers token load and cost.

Prompt caching

Reusing the same long context? Caching can slash input cost. DeepSeek Chat lists cached input around $0.027 per million tokens. GPT-4o Mini lists cached input around $0.075 per million. Great for chat over one big PDF or policy doc.

Batch APIs and DeepSeek Chat / GPT-4o Mini

If you do not need instant replies, batch jobs often run at a steep discount (often around half off list price, depending on the provider). Ship a file of requests, get results within about a day. Ideal for summaries, translations, and backfills. Use the calculator toggles above to see how batch mode changes your estimate.

Architecture & ops

Hidden cost: system prompts

System prompts ride along on every call. Example: 1,000 tokens × 100,000 requests per day ≈ 100M input tokens daily. At $0.07 per million for DeepSeek Chat, that is about $7.00 per day from the system prompt alone. Keep instructions short and reusable.

RAG and retrieval costs

RAG sends retrieved chunks with each question. More chunks mean more input tokens to DeepSeek Chat or OpenAI GPT-4o Mini. Tighten retrieval: send only the best few passages, not whole folders.

Fine-tuning vs longer prompts

Long prompts tax you every request. Fine-tuning costs upfront but can shorten prompts. Compare total cost in our calculator: long prompt + cheap base model vs short prompt + fine-tuned pricing if you use it.

Agents and loops

Agents may call DeepSeek Chat or OpenAI GPT-4o Mini many times per user task. One workflow can equal dozens of normal chat turns. Cap steps, log spend, and alert on spikes.

Billing SaaS customers for AI

Flat plans get burned by power users on DeepSeek Chat or OpenAI GPT-4o Mini. Credits or BYOK (bring your own key) align revenue with cost.

Track real usage

Dashboards, alerts, and tools like Helicone or Langfuse show who burns tokens and which prompts bloat bills. Measure before you optimize.
